Firstly, determining the best time to take a vacation is crucial. Many people prefer to travel during peak seasons, such as summer or winter holidays, when the weather is favorable and there are numerous events and attractions to enjoy. However, this often means higher prices and crowded destinations. Alternatively, traveling during the off-season can lead to better deals and fewer tourists. It’s essential to research the climate and events of your chosen destination to find the perfect time for your vacation.
Once you’ve decided on the ideal time, the next step is to plan how you will spend your vacation. This involves considering your interests, budget, and the type of experience you’re looking for. For instance, if you’re interested in outdoor activities, you might choose a destination with mountains or beaches. If you prefer cultural experiences, a city break might be more appealing. Setting a budget will help you prioritize your expenses and ensure that you don’t overspend during your trip.
When it comes to how to vacation, there are various options to choose from. Some people prefer to travel independently, planning every aspect of their trip themselves. This approach offers flexibility and the opportunity to tailor your experience to your preferences. On the other hand, many opt for package tours, which provide convenience and a structured itinerary. Group tours can be an excellent choice for those who enjoy the company of like-minded travelers and want to explore new places with the guidance of a knowledgeable tour guide.
Another factor to consider is how you’ll travel to your destination. Flying is often the fastest and most convenient option, but it can also be expensive and environmentally unfriendly. Train travel, on the other hand, can be a more scenic and cost-effective alternative, especially for long-distance trips. If you’re up for an adventure, consider road trips or even walking tours, which can offer a unique and authentic experience.
Lastly, don’t forget to plan for the unexpected. Make sure you have travel insurance, a backup plan for accommodation, and a way to stay connected with friends and family. By being prepared, you can enjoy your vacation without worrying about potential problems.
